The revelation

A girl stood placidly in the middle of a plain. The slight breeze played tantalizingly with her swaying hair. The afternoon sky appeared to be indecisive today; the sun blazed through a bleak, moody gray backdrop. The girl shuddered to think what would happen if she was caught in a gale whilst in the midst of this sprawling field. For one moment, she took advantage of the silence around her and let out a piercing scream which nobody would hear except herself. The scream echoed through the plain and through her body, affecting her inside, ripping apart the scars which healed half-heartedly, making them gush out blood. Her body trembled and she crumpled up weak, on the ground. She did not show emotion, as she was now impervious to this destructive feeling. Instead, as she gazed across vacantly, she imagined an alternative. A beautiful alternative. A drop of rain splattered across her cheek. She got up and tried to run for shelter but an invisible force yanked at her ankles, sending her crashing to the ground, laughing cruelly at the struggle taking place before its eyes. After a few relentless tries, she accepted the rain washing over her body, soaking her to the bone, and then, with a sudden crystal clear decision, got up, embracing the inivisble force as an old friend.
